> Thank you for your bug report, could you explain the meaning of tilda
> ~ in versions dependencies ? I can't find an explanation in debian
> docs.
It's useful to allow dependencies to be satisfied with pre-released
versions[0] (such as RC) and also to allow using backported packages for
rails (as backport version is something like 2.3.11-1~bpo60+1 for
2.3.11-1).
You can easily check with dpkg --compare-versions:
$ dpkg --compare-versions '2.3.11-1' '>' '2.3.11-1~bpo60+1' && echo true || echo false
true
BTW, after checking TMail, it does not seem necessary to explicitely add
it as ruby-rails-2.3 (2.3.14-2 but I dunno for older versions) depends
upon ruby-actionmailer-2.3 which in turn depends on ruby-tmail >=
1.2.7~, but it's up to you of course as I don't know anything about
Rails ;).
